Signature Print or Type Name YOU ARE HEREBY NOTIFIED that the above named Plaintiff has filed a claim against you amounting to $ ; the reasons for which are stated below. YOU ARE HEREBY FURTHER NOTIFIED to be and appear at Jefferson County District Court 1820 Jefferson Street Port Townsend, Washington on ______________________, 20_____ at ______________ a.m../p.m. for MEDIATION TRIAL. You are to bring with you any and all papers, contracts and proof needed by you to establish or defend this claim. At the time of trial you must bring any witnesses who will testify on your behalf. YOU ARE FURTHER NOTIFIED that if you fail to personally appear as directed, a Judgment may be entered against you for the amount claimed, plus Plaintiff's costs of filing and service of the claim upon you. Plaintiff must also appear if a Judgment is to be entered. If Plaintiff fails to appear, the claim may be dismissed. If this claim is settled prior to the hearing date, the parties must notify the Court immediately, in writing. Clerk American LegalNet, Inc. www.USCourtForms.com
